           Why Hydrogen Cars Deserve a Second Look

           Hydrogen cars are often talked about as “the future of clean transport,” yet many drivers still aren’t sure how they work or why they matter. Over the last decade, electric vehicles have dominated the conversation, but hydrogen is quietly becoming one of the most promising zero‑emission technologies in the world. As countries invest in cleaner energy and manufacturers explore alternatives to large lithium‑ion batteries, hydrogen cars are finally getting the attention they deserve.

           Hydrogen vehicles are, at their core, electric cars. The difference is how they create and store energy. Instead of relying on a heavy battery pack, hydrogen cars use a fuel cell that combines hydrogen with oxygen to produce electricity. The process is silent, efficient, and produces only water vapour. This means hydrogen cars offer the smooth, quiet driving experience of an EV, but with the convenience of fast refuelling and long range.

           One of the biggest advantages of hydrogen is refuelling time. Drivers can fill up a hydrogen tank in just a few minutes, similar to petrol or diesel. For people who travel long distances, run commercial fleets, or simply don’t want to wait for a battery to charge, this is a major benefit. Many hydrogen models also achieve ranges of 500 to 650 kilometres, making them ideal for motorway driving and long‑distance travel.

           Hydrogen also avoids the environmental impact of lithium and cobalt mining. While battery‑electric vehicles are an important part of the clean‑energy transition, their production requires significant mineral extraction. Hydrogen fuel‑cell vehicles use lightweight systems and do not rely on large battery packs, offering a different path toward sustainable transport.

           Of course, hydrogen still faces challenges. Refuelling stations are limited, and production methods vary in how environmentally friendly they are. But these challenges are not unlike the early days of electric vehicles, when charging points were rare and battery technology was still developing. Today, governments and manufacturers around the world are investing heavily in hydrogen infrastructure, renewable hydrogen production, and new fuel‑cell vehicle models.

           Hydrogen cars deserve a second look because they offer something unique: zero‑emission driving without compromise. They combine the best parts of electric vehicles with the practicality of fast refuelling and long range. As clean‑energy technology continues to evolve, hydrogen is becoming a realistic and scalable solution for drivers, businesses, and countries aiming for a greener future.
